Quoted:
I have the standard RRA A1 flash hider, but I see the 3 lugs around too. Where do these come from?

These (3 lug) are either cut to the barrel when it is custom made from a blank, or an existing barrel is threaded to accept a 3 lug adapter.   Look at TROS on his barrel and adapter pages.

Is here a 9mm phantom FH available?
Just get the Phantom to match your barrel thread, typically 1/2-28 (on custom barrels) unless you have a 1/2-36, and use it, just take a 3/8 bit and open it if it will not pass a 9mm bullet.
